The level of punditry in the most prominent programs is dire. I'm glad this was called out.

The shame is that there are plenty of knowledgeable journalists out there such as Huw Davies. The problem is that pundits are often picked because they're ex pros, usually former internationals, who played well 10 years ago but never really paid attention to the nuances of the game, they were just good in their particular position.

Now they're being asked for their opinions and have nothing much to say beyond either the blindingly obvious or lazy stereotypes, because they dont have enough love or interest in the game to actually do their own research.

It's like asking an actor to comment on screenwriting or direction. Their skill in playing a particular part doesnt mean they understand how the structure of the whole story was created and put together.
